D49.7
ICD-10-CMNeoplasm of unspecified behavior of endocrine glands and other parts of nervous system
This code signifies a tumor of an endocrine gland or a component of the nervous system where the pathologist has not yet determined if it is benign or malignant. It represents an unconfirmed neoplastic growth within structures like the pituitary, thyroid, adrenal glands, or parts of the central nervous system.
Use this code when diagnostic workup, such as biopsy or definitive imaging, is pending or inconclusive regarding the tumor's behavior (benign vs. malignant). This code is appropriate when documentation explicitly states "neoplasm of uncertain behavior" or "unspecified behavior" affecting an endocrine gland or nervous system structure, excluding peripheral nerves.
